My Travel # 1 Choice: Bowflex Select Dumbbells Tech

I like this because they combine 15 sets of weights into one. All it takes is a dial turn and you can change the resistance from £ 5 to 52.5 pounds.

The Select Tech is perfect to be with you as they take up no space and you can use it to get in quick training on the go.

If you don't have a gym in your home gym, I strongly recommend investing in a set. (You can also do the exercises I have for you downstairs at home)

My Travel Choice # 2: Aqua Bell Dumbbells

If you are traveling by plane, you will not be able to carry your Select Tech trust but you can carry a pair of Aqua Bell Dumbbells instead.

I like Aqua Bell because all you have to do to adjust the weight is just add water. Then you just empty it and they are packed in your suitcase.

They only weigh 16 pounds each, so they are not as heavy as Select Tech but they are very easy to travel with, and will get the job.

If you are looking for a cheap dumbbell to take with you when traveling by plane, this may be your best bet.

Here are the exercises: You'll go through the circuit every once in a while. (If you're feeling motivated though, don't be afraid to challenge yourself and do the circuit twice)

APPLY A

Heating: Jumping Jacks - 60 seconds + Jog in place - 60 seconds + 10 pushups

1) Split Jumps - 60 seconds

2) Close Grip Pushups -15

3) Dumbbell Bicep Curl - 15

4) Burpees - 60 seconds

5) Shoulder Dumbbell Seat Press - 15

6) Dumbbell Bent Over Row - 15

7) Bulgarian split leg (foot on bed) - 10 / side

8) Mountain Climber - 60 seconds

9) Squat by pressing dumbbell - 15

10) Hindu Pushups- 15

11) Squat Jump to bed (shoes) - 60 seconds

12) Legs in bed push pushups - 15

13) Reverse Crunch - 20

14) Plank - 60 seconds

WORKOUT B

Heating: Jumping Jacks - 60 seconds + Jog in place - 60 seconds + 10 pushups

1) Hold Squats - 60 seconds

2) Walk Out Pushups - 12

3) Dumbbell Lat Raise (shoulder) - 15

4) Shadow Boxing - 60 seconds

5) Raise Dumbbell Kids Calf - 20

6) 1 foot squats (holding to table) - 8 / foot

7) Punch a fool - 12

8) Jump Squats - 60 seconds

9) Straight-leg deadlifts - 12

10) Dumbbell Jumping Snatch to Bed - 10 / side

11) 180 pushup jumps

12) Shadow Boxing - 60 seconds

13) Crunch return - 20

14) Plank - 60 seconds

WORKOUT C (no equipment required)

Heating: Jumping Jacks - 60 seconds + Jog in place - 60 seconds + 10 pushups

1) Burpees - 60 seconds

2) Mountain Climber - 60 seconds

3) Arm Tied Arm - 15

4) Pushups Handstand - 10

5) Jumping to Bed - 15

6) Weight Loss Calf - 15 / side

7) Close Pushups - 15

8) Superman's - 15

9) Sit-Up Casket - 15

10) Bulgarian Split Squat (foot on the bed) - 10 / side

11) Shadow Boxing - 60 seconds

12) Prison Squats - 60 seconds

13) Walk Out Pushups - 10

14) Duck Walks - (length of space x 2)

15) Reverse Crunch - 20

16) Board - 60 seconds
